Select the verbal phrase that corresponds with the given expression. (a – b)2

\[(a-b)^2\]\ \[(a-b)(a-b)\]
\[a^2-2ab+b^2\]
(a-b)^2 is the whole square of the difference of a and b

This is a perfect square trinomial. You can also say that this is the square of the binomial a-b
